Uncracked

Uncracked develops seaweed-based functional food ingredients using its SeaStack technology to replace artificial additives in the food and beverage industry. By utilizing nutrient-dense, carbon-capturing macroalgae, the company provides clean-label solutions that enhance food products without synthetic additives or toxins.

Problem

Many processed foods rely on artificial additives to achieve desired functionality, but these synthetic ingredients can be detrimental to consumer health and are often viewed negatively by health-conscious consumers. Food manufacturers need clean-label alternatives that provide the same functional benefits without the use of artificial or harmful substances.

Solution

Uncracked develops seaweed-based functional food ingredients that serve as replacements for artificial additives in the food and beverage industry. Their SeaStack technology utilizes nutrient-dense macroalgae to provide clean-label solutions that enhance food products. The resulting ingredients are designed to be neutral in flavor and color, making them versatile for a variety of applications. Uncracked's limited processing methods preserve the essential nutrients of seaweed while delivering natural functionality without synthetic additives or toxins.

Target Audience

Uncracked's primary customers are food and beverage manufacturers seeking clean-label alternatives to artificial additives for their product formulations.

Features

  • SeaStack technology leverages carbon-capturing macroalgae as a base ingredient.
  • Whole form seaweed and seaweed extracts sourced from domestic farms.
  • Ingredients are neutral in flavor and color for broad applicability.
  • Limited processing methods to maintain essential nutrients.
  • Provides natural functionality without the need for artificial additives.
